Explain the hot pursuit warrant exception and the reasons the Supreme Court has identified that justify the exception.

Answer to Question 1

Answer: Answers will define exigent circumstances in general and the various issues associated with hot pursuit, including warrantless entries into residences, the need for the police to have reason to believe the suspect will escape or evidence will be destroyed absent immediate action, the limitation that the police cannot have created the exigency, and the scope of the searched limited by the nature of the circumstances.

The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) was originally known as the Communicable Disease Center, which was formed to fight malaria. It was originally headquartered in Atlanta, Georgia, since the Southern states faced the worst threat from malaria.

Over time, chronic hepatitis B virus and hepatitis C virus infections can progress to advanced liver disease, liver failure, and hepatocellular carcinoma. Unlike other forms, more than 80% of hepatitis C infections become chronic and lead to liver disease. When combined with hepatitis B, hepatitis C now accounts for 75% percent of all cases of liver disease around the world. Liver failure caused by hepatitis C is now leading cause of liver transplants in the United States.
